methylClass: an R package to construct DNA methylation-based classification models
1Laboratory of Pathology, Center for Cancer Research, National Cancer Institute, Bethesda, MD 20892, USA.
Abstract:
DNA methylation profiling is a useful tool to increase the accuracy of a cancer diagnosis. However, a comprehensive R package specially for it is lacking. Hence, we developed the R package methylClass for methylation-based classification. Within it, we provide the eSVM (ensemble-based support vector machine) model to achieve much higher accuracy in methylation data classification than the popular random forest model and overcome the time-consuming problem of the traditional SVM. In addition, some novel feature selection methods are included in the package to improve the classification. Furthermore, because methylation data can be converted to other omics, such as copy number variation data, we also provide functions for multi-omics studies. The testing of this package on four datasets shows the accurate performance of our package, especially eSVM, which can be used in both methylation and multi-omics models and outperforms other methods in both cases. methylClass is available at: https://github.com/yuabrahamliu/methylClass.
